Closed Bug 545959 Opened 14 years ago Closed 14 years ago

crash [@ nsRegionRectIterator::Reset()] |... [@ nsMIMEInfoWin::LoadUriInternal] handling attachment or clicking URL link in XP via browseui.dll

Categories

(MailNews Core :: Attachments, defect)

x86
Windows XP
defect
Not set
critical

Tracking

(Not tracked)

RESOLVED DUPLICATE of bug 593847

People

(Reporter: wsmwk, Unassigned)

Details

(Keywords: crash)

Crash Data

crash [@ nsRegionRectIterator::Reset()]

#21 crash for 3.0.1, windows-only
crash is not seen prior to 3.0b4
most comments mention opening or saving attachment, adding attachment to new message, and clicking links

bp-6138b0f6-8aa1-4579-99d0-c7e462091209 (no extensions listed) is interesting because the reporter writes...
after i open some link from mail, or open attathment, this happend also in thunderbird 2.0.x

0	thunderbird.exe	nsRegionRectIterator::Reset	 objdir-tb/mozilla/dist/include/gfx/nsRegion.h:265
1	browseui.dll	GetUEMSettings	
2	browseui.dll	CUserAssist::Initialize	
3	browseui.dll	CUserAssist_CI2	
4	browseui.dll	CUserAssist_CreateInstance	
5	browseui.dll	CClassFactory::CreateInstance	
6	ole32.dll	[thunk]:`vcall'{36,{flat}}' }'	
7	ole32.dll	ActivationPropertiesIn::DelegateCreateInstance	
8	ole32.dll	CApartmentActivator::CreateInstance	
9	ole32.dll	CProcessActivator::CCICallback	
10	ole32.dll	CProcessActivator::AttemptActivation	
11	ole32.dll	CProcessActivator::ActivateByContext	
12	ole32.dll	CProcessActivator::CreateInstance	
13	ole32.dll	ActivationPropertiesIn::DelegateCreateInstance	
14	ole32.dll	CClientContextActivator::CreateInstance	
15	ole32.dll	ActivationPropertiesIn::DelegateCreateInstance	
16	ole32.dll	ActivationPropertiesOut::Initialize	
17	ole32.dll	CComActivator::DoCreateInstance	
18	ole32.dll	CoCreateInstanceEx	
19	ole32.dll	CoCreateInstance	
20	shell32.dll	ATL::CComObject<CStartMenuPin>::CComObject<CStartMenuPin>	
21	shell32.dll	UEMFireEvent	
22	shell32.dll	CShellExecute::ExecuteNormal	
23	shell32.dll	ShellExecuteNormal	
24	shell32.dll	ShellExecuteExW	
25	shlwapi.dll	ShellExecuteExWrapW	
26	shdocvw.dll	shdocvw.dll@0x888fd	
27	shdocvw.dll	shdocvw.dll@0x882bc	
28	shell32.dll	_InvokeInProcExec	
29	shell32.dll	CShellExecute::_ShellExecPidl	
30	shell32.dll	CShellExecute::_DoExecPidl	
31	shell32.dll	_aullrem	
32	shell32.dll	CShellExecute::ExecuteNormal	
33	shell32.dll	ShellExecuteNormal	
34	shell32.dll	ShellExecuteExW	
35	thunderbird.exe	nsMIMEInfoWin::LoadUriInternal	uriloader/exthandler/win/nsMIMEInfoWin.cpp:328
36	thunderbird.exe	nsMIMEInfoBase::LaunchWithURI	uriloader/exthandler/nsMIMEInfoImpl.cpp:397
37	thunderbird.exe	nsExternalHelperAppService::LoadURI	uriloader/exthandler/nsExternalHelperAppService.cpp:911
38	thunderbird.exe	nsExternalHelperAppService::LoadUrl	uriloader/exthandler/nsExternalHelperAppService.cpp:849
39	thunderbird.exe	nsMessenger::LaunchExternalURL	mailnews/base/src/nsMessenger.cpp:595 

bp-1ac79f98-9d5d-4095-8e9e-6f9202100204
Trying to save an attachment crashes Thunderbird. Arggg, this is so annoying. It does the same thing when clicking a link in an email as well.

bp-8fa867e7-b80b-494e-a546-c93f02091216
just clicked a link to web page
0	thunderbird.exe	nsRegionRectIterator::Reset	 objdir-tb/mozilla/dist/include/gfx/nsRegion.h:265
1	browseui.dll	GetUEMSettings	
2	browseui.dll	CUserAssist::Initialize	
3	browseui.dll	CUserAssist_CI2	
4	browseui.dll	CUserAssist_CreateInstance	
5	browseui.dll	CClassFactory::CreateInstance	
6	ole32.dll	[thunk]:`vcall'{36,{flat}}' }'	
7	ole32.dll	ActivationPropertiesIn::DelegateCreateInstance	
8	ole32.dll	CApartmentActivator::CreateInstance	
9	ole32.dll	CProcessActivator::CCICallback	
10	ole32.dll	CProcessActivator::AttemptActivation	
11	ole32.dll	CProcessActivator::ActivateByContext	
12	ole32.dll	CProcessActivator::CreateInstance	
13	ole32.dll	ActivationPropertiesIn::DelegateCreateInstance	
14	ole32.dll	CClientContextActivator::CreateInstance	
15	ole32.dll	ActivationPropertiesIn::DelegateCreateInstance	
16	ole32.dll	ActivationPropertiesOut::Initialize	
17	ole32.dll	CComActivator::DoCreateInstance	
18	ole32.dll	CoCreateInstanceEx	
19	ole32.dll	CoCreateInstance	
20	shell32.dll	ATL::CComObject<CStartMenuPin>::CComObject<CStartMenuPin>	
21	shell32.dll	UEMFireEvent	
22	shell32.dll	CShellExecute::ExecuteNormal	
23	shell32.dll	ShellExecuteNormal	
24	shell32.dll	ShellExecuteExW	
25	shlwapi.dll	ShellExecuteExWrapW	
26	shdocvw.dll	shdocvw.dll@0x888fd	
27	shdocvw.dll	shdocvw.dll@0x882bc	
28	shell32.dll	_InvokeInProcExec	
29	shell32.dll	CShellExecute::_ShellExecPidl	
30	shell32.dll	CShellExecute::_DoExecPidl	
31	shell32.dll	_aullrem	
32	shell32.dll	CShellExecute::ExecuteNormal	
33	shell32.dll	ShellExecuteNormal	
34	shell32.dll	ShellExecuteExW	
35	thunderbird.exe	nsMIMEInfoWin::LoadUriInternal	uriloader/exthandler/win/nsMIMEInfoWin.cpp:328
36	thunderbird.exe	nsMIMEInfoBase::LaunchWithURI	uriloader/exthandler/nsMIMEInfoImpl.cpp:397
37	thunderbird.exe	nsExternalHelperAppService::LoadURI	uriloader/exthandler/nsExternalHelperAppService.cpp:911
38	thunderbird.exe	nsExternalHelperAppService::LoadUrl	uriloader/exthandler/nsExternalHelperAppService.cpp:849
39	xpcom_core.dll	NS_InvokeByIndex_P	xpcom/reflect/xptcall/src/md/win32/xptcinvoke.cpp:101
this crash doesn't exist in version 3.1. I bet the signature morphed to bug 593847
Status: NEW → RESOLVED
Closed: 14 years ago
OS: Windows Vista → Windows XP
Resolution: --- → DUPLICATE
Summary: crash [@ nsRegionRectIterator::Reset()] handling attachment or clicking URL link → crash [@ nsRegionRectIterator::Reset()] |... [@ nsMIMEInfoWin::LoadUriInternal] handling attachment or clicking URL link in XP via browseui.dll
Crash Signature: [@ nsRegionRectIterator::Reset()] [@ nsMIMEInfoWin::LoadUriInternal]
You need to log in before you can comment on or make changes to this bug.